proximity alert system
A proximity alert system represents a cutting-edge safety technology designed to detect and warn operators when objects, vehicles, or personnel enter predefined danger zones around heavy machinery or equipment. This sophisticated monitoring solution utilizes advanced sensors, radar technology, and intelligent software algorithms to create invisible safety boundaries that protect both workers and valuable assets in industrial environments. The proximity alert system continuously monitors the surrounding area, instantly identifying potential collision risks and delivering immediate warnings through visual, audible, and tactile alerts. Modern proximity alert systems integrate multiple detection technologies including ultrasonic sensors, radar units, camera systems, and GPS tracking to ensure comprehensive coverage and reliable performance across diverse operational conditions. These systems feature customizable detection zones that operators can adjust based on specific equipment dimensions, working environments, and safety requirements. The technology processes real-time data from multiple sensors simultaneously, filtering environmental interference while maintaining high sensitivity to genuine threats. Advanced proximity alert systems incorporate machine learning capabilities that adapt to changing site conditions and reduce false alarms over time. The system architecture typically includes sensor modules mounted on equipment, central processing units that analyze incoming data, and alert mechanisms positioned within operator visibility and hearing range. Integration capabilities allow proximity alert systems to connect with existing fleet management software, telematics platforms, and safety monitoring networks. Data logging features record all proximity events, enabling safety managers to analyze incident patterns, identify high-risk areas, and implement targeted safety improvements. Weather-resistant construction ensures reliable operation in harsh industrial environments including construction sites, mining operations, warehouses, and manufacturing facilities. The proximity alert system supports various equipment types from excavators and cranes to forklifts and agricultural machinery, providing scalable safety solutions across multiple industries.
